As a Swiss watch house Baume Et Mercier has been producing luxury watches since 1830.  Their time pieces have graced the wrists of notables such as Ashton Kutcher, Andy Garcia, Gwenyth Paltrow, Kim Basinger and more.

The chronometer movement is based on a Swiss ETA 7750 series which has been customized for B&M by La-Joux & Perret (their model 8120)

From the B&M website:

With a design inspired by a model initially launched in 1948, this chronograph, the flagship model of the Capeland collection, impresses with its 44 mm-diameter steel case with a balanced and dynamic design. This timepiece, water-resistant to 50 meters, is driven by a finely-crafted automatic mechanical caliber (La Joux Perret 8120), visible through a transparent sapphire case-back. Chic and elegant, it is proposed with a sun satin-finished blue dial, snailed black counters and a date aperture. It features two graduated scales: one tachymetric and the other telemetric, highlighted by red markings. Timepiece that is more sport-oriented, it is worn with an integrated bracelet in polished/satin-finished steel, closed by a triple folding clasp with security push-pieces.
